Web27 Mar 2015 · setw sets the width of the next output operation. If you do setw (50) and then output something that is 24 characters long 26 extra spaces will be outputted to fill up all the 50 characters. So if you want the description column to be 50 characters wide you can use setw (50) before outputting Inventory [ i].getDescription () just like you do in ... WebC++ manipulator setw function stands for set width. This manipulator is used to specify the minimum number of character positions on the output field a variable will consume. This manipulator is declared in header file . Syntax /*unspecified*/ setw (int n); Parameter n: number of characters to be used as filed width.
